1000 Sq Ft Building Plan: A Comprehensive Guide

Designing a 1000 sq ft building plan requires careful planning and consideration of space utilization. This guide will provide insights into creating a functional and aesthetically pleasing layout for a 1000 sq ft building.

Space Allocation

The first step is to allocate space according to the intended purpose of the building. Determine the number of bedrooms, bathrooms, living spaces, and other essential areas. A typical allocation for a 1000 sq ft building could be:

  • Bedrooms: 2-3
  • Bathrooms: 1-2
  • Living Room: 1
  • Kitchen: 1
  • Dining Area: 1
  • Utility/Laundry: 1

Efficient Layout

Once the space allocation is defined, the layout should be planned to maximize space utilization and flow. Consider the following principles:

  • Open Floor Plan: Create an open and spacious feeling by connecting the living room, dining area, and kitchen into a single large space.
  • Natural Light: Position windows and doors strategically to flood the building with natural light, reducing the need for artificial lighting.
  • Multi-Purpose Rooms: Design rooms that can serve multiple functions, such as a guest bedroom that doubles as an office.

Kitchen Design

The kitchen is a crucial space that requires careful planning. Consider the following tips:

  • Kitchen Triangle: Position the refrigerator, sink, and stove in a triangle formation to optimize work efficiency.
  • Storage Capacity: Plan for ample storage cabinets and drawers to keep the kitchen clutter-free.
  • Countertop Space: Provide sufficient countertop space for food preparation and storage.

Bathroom Design

Bathrooms should be designed for both functionality and comfort:

  • Separate Shower and Tub: If possible, create separate shower and bathtub areas to provide more flexibility.
  • Vanity Space: Plan a vanity with ample counter space and storage for toiletries and personal items.
  • Ventilation: Ensure adequate ventilation to prevent moisture buildup and mold growth.

Energy Efficiency

Incorporating energy-efficient features into the building plan can reduce operating costs:

  • Insulation: Use high-quality insulation in walls, ceilings, and floors to minimize heat loss and gain.
  • Windows and Doors: Choose energy-efficient windows and doors that prevent drafts and heat transfer.
  • Lighting: Install LED lighting throughout the building for energy savings and longer bulb life.

Additional Considerations

Other factors to consider include:

  • Outdoor Space: Plan for a patio, deck, or balcony to extend living space outdoors.
  • Storage: Include ample closet space, pantries, and other storage solutions throughout the building.
  • Accessibility: Ensure the building is accessible to all occupants, including individuals with disabilities.

By following these guidelines, you can create a functional, comfortable, and energy-efficient 1000 sq ft building plan that meets your specific needs.
